Geometry Geometry angle question

So the way I see it there are two quadrilaterals here. The “boomerang” one with each side high lighted in a different color, and the inner weird shaped square-ish one.

For the boomerangs one - 90 plus 40 plus 30 = 160 so 360 - 160 =200 so X must be 200

For the inner square-ish one -

90 plus 30 is 120 so the other angle should be 60
90 plus 40 is 130 so the other angle should be 50
90 plus 50 plus 60 = 200 so X must be 160.

The correct answer is 160 so I know it’s the square-ish one but I don’t know why - which means on the test I won’t know which one to solve for and I’ll get the question wrong. How do you know which one to solve for?

I think you're kinda going about it the hard way.

The angle inside on thee right is 60, so the small right sided triangle has angles of 40, 120, and 20.

So on the center you have two 20 degree angles opposing each other. Meaning the others, including x, are (360-20-20)/2 = 160.

Anyway, the large angle inside the boomerang is 200. But that's not what x is. X is equal to it's opposite, which is what's left over of 360 from 200. Or 160.
